With so much talk about summer brain drain, Iโ€™m always looking for activities to keep my kids learning without realizing it. Thatโ€™s why I love this DIY that helps kids answer the perennial question: What did you do over your summer vacation?

 

At Dana Made It, youโ€™ll find a tutorial for handmade summer story journals that you can hand sew, although if youโ€™re me, Iโ€™d bet a binder or some staples would be just fine. She includes a 3-page template you can copy too.

I know my kids would have a blast filling it out with their memories, adventures, special days, or even just the birds they spotted in one day. And thereโ€™s something about a color-your-own cover that makes it that much more special than a marbled composition book. โ€“Liz
